I think you need to ask your vet. Baby food is not nutritionally complete. It's missing taurine as well as other elements. The FF does make up for it but it really depends on how much of each Izzy is eating. If you give a taurine supplement, I don't know if there's an issue with a cat getting too much taurine vs. not enough.

If the constipation is an on-going issue, that's also something that your vet needs to address. It may be that there's a motility issue and some medication is needed. Zener has that issue and Anne and Liz give their kitty Reglan (I think).
 
Have you tried using pumpkin? That can help w/ constipation and can be a regular part of the diet. Hearts are a good source of taurine, you can get chicken hearts for the butcher.
